The procedure of professional Termite Inspections Belconnen is a precise examination that goes far beyond a basic walk through your home. Experienced technicians are trained to search for the most subtle indications that an infestation is either present or impending. They analyze the entire perimeter of the structure for mud tubes which are small tunnels built from soil and debris that termites use to take a trip in between the ground and a food source while staying hydrated and protected from light. In the Australian Capital Territory where temperature level changes can be severe these tunnels are a main indication that a colony is active nearby. A thorough check also includes the roofing system space and the subfloor locations where termites are probably to go into undetected through tiny cracks in the structures or along pipes lines that penetrate the concrete slab.
Modern innovation has considerably enhanced the accuracy of these assessments over the last couple of years. While a visual check stays the structure of the procedure high quality Termite Inspections Belconnen now utilize specialized tools such as wetness meters and thermal imaging electronic cameras. Termites create heat and wetness within their galleries and these devices allow experts to see through plasterboard and wood to find active nests that would otherwise stay covert behind walls. Moisture meters are especially useful since dampness in walls often suggests a leakage or a termite nest both of which require instant attention to prevent structural compromise. By using these non invasive methods service technicians can supply a detailed evaluation of the property health without needing to cause any physical damage during the preliminary check.
The layout of Belconnen's terrain likewise influences how typically and where these inspections are concentrated. Many residences in neighborhoods such as Aranda or Macquarie sit adjacent to thick bushland reserves that serve as natural habitats for termites. Regular termite inspections in Belconnen usually include evaluating the large trees and stumps that lie within a home's limitations. When a considerable colony is found nesting in a backyard gum tree, it becomes an instant risk to the home, as termites can take a trip significant distances from their primary nest. Identifying these outdoors threats early allows homeowners to set up preventive barriers or baiting systems before the pests reach the primary structure. It is significantly more effective to capture a colony in the garden than to contend with one that has actually currently taken hold in roof trusses or flooring joists.
Homeowners also contribute considerably to the effectiveness of these assessments by acknowledging the conditions that welcome pests. An inspector will usually determine areas that prefer termites, such as inadequate subfloor ventilation, raised garden beds that obstruct weep read more holes, or dripping faucets that keep the soil damp. Fixing a leaking pipeline or making sure garden beds are not in contact with the brickwork can render a property far less attractive to wandering insects. When these uncomplicated maintenance procedures are paired with expert termite inspections in Belconnen, the possibility of a serious invasion drops significantly. Professionals normally recommend conducting a comprehensive inspection a minimum of once a year to find any new activity early, before it evolves into a significant structural problem.
For those looking to purchase a new residential or commercial property in the area the importance of a pre purchase check can not be overstated. It ensures that the buyer is totally aware of any past or present activity before committing to a considerable financial investment. Even in newer developments where physical barriers were set up throughout building and construction an inspection is necessary to validate that the barriers have not been bridged by landscaping remodellings or the installation of brand-new services.
